Certification of payments due; pay of Major Tousard & His Men
Document 1797Certification that $472 is due Lts. Henry Muhlenberg and George Ross, Surgeon's Mate John R. Lynch, and Major Lewis Tousard and the detachment of the Corps of Artillerists and Engineers under his command at Mud Island Fort, being his and their pay for September 1797 including forage for himself and Lynch and the balance of bounties due the non-commissioned officers and privates.
